Learning & Development Manager
Job Purpose
We are looking for an experienced Senior Manager, Learning & Development to lead and manage the company’s learning and development initiatives.
The role will work closely with business leaders, operations and HR to understand training needs, develop suitable programmes and support the development of employees at all levels.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and implement the company’s learning and development plans.
- Identify training and capability gaps across the business.
- Work with department heads to understand training needs and recommend suitable programmes.
- Develop and manage leadership, supervisory and employee development programmes.
- Support career development, talent development and succession planning initiatives.
- Manage the full training process, including planning, coordination, delivery and evaluation.
- Develop training materials, e-learning content and other learning resources.
- Manage and improve the use of the company’s Learning Management System and digital learning tools.
- Track training attendance, completion and effectiveness.
- Prepare regular training reports and provide recommendations for improvement.
- Manage external training providers and vendors.
- Support mandatory, compliance and operational training requirements.
- Keep up to date with relevant training grants, funding schemes and workforce development programmes.
- Support other HR and employee development initiatives where required.
